The Importance of a Proper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ection Process

With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ection, a proper process is crucial to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living environment. Our team follows a meticulous process that includes:

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our technicians assess the damage and contain the affected area to prevent further contamination. This step typically takes 30 minutes to an hour, depending on the severity of the situation.

Step 2: Sewage Extraction

We use advanced equipment to extract the sewage, taking care to remove all contaminated materials and prevent re-contamination. This step can take anywhere from 2-5 hours, depending on the size of the affected area.

Step 3: Disinfection and Sanitizing

Our team uses EPA-registered disinfectants to sanitize the affected area, ensuring a safe living environment for you and your family. This step typically takes 2-3 hours, depending on the size of the area.

Step 4: Drying and Dehumidification

We use industrial-strength drying equipment to dry the affected area, preventing further damage and mold growth. This step can take anywhere from 2-5 days, depending on the severity of the situation.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Clearance

Our technicians con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is safe and clear of any remaining contaminants. This step typically takes 30 minutes to an hour, depending on the size of the area.

Warning Signs You Need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Keep an eye out for these signs, and don’t hesitate to call our team if you notice any of the following: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show a sewage backup or leak. If you notice a persistent smell,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Water Stains on Your Walls or Ceiling

Water stains can be a sign of a hidden leak or sewage backup.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and health hazards.

Sewage-Related Health Risks

Exposure to sewage can lead to serious health risks, including skin infections, respiratory problems, and even disease transmission. If you’ve been exposed to sewage, it’s crucial to seek medical attention and contact our team for professional cleanup and disinfection.

Visible Signs of Water Damage

Water damage can be a sign of a sewage backup or leak. Keep an eye out for warped flooring, water-stained walls, and other signs of water damage.

Unusual Sounds or Gurgling Noises

Unusual sounds or gurgling noises can show a sewage backup or leak. If you notice any of these signs, don’t hesitate to contact our team for professional help.

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ak with minimal water damage Yes No You can likely fix the leak yourself with some basic plumbing knowledge.
Large sewage backup with extensive water damage No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to safely and effectively clean up the area.
Hidden leak with unknown source No Yes A professional can help you locate the source of the leak and make the necessary repairs.
Severe health risks due to sewage exposure No Yes Professional cleanup and disinfection are essential to prevent further health risks.
Insurance claim is disputed or unclear No Yes A professional can help you navigate the claims process and ensure you receive the coverage you deserve.
Area is too large or complex for DIY cleanup No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to safely and effectively clean up the area.

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ection Cost In Hooper, UT

The cost of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ection can vary depending on the severity of the situation,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Hooper, UT.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500, but these can vary depending on the specifics of the job.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a personalized plan that fits your budget and need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Sewage Extraction $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of situation
Disinfection and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of disinfectant used
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Final Inspection and Clearance $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of inspection
Insurance Support and Claims Help Free – $500 Complexity of claims process, amount of support needed
Emergency Response and After-Hours Service $100 – $500 Time of day, urgency of situation
